How to improve the reliability of automotive brushless motors?

As a supplier in the automotive brushless motor industry, I understand the critical role reliability plays in this field. Automotive brushless motors are used in a wide range of applications, from electric power steering systems and engine cooling fans to electric vehicle drivetrains. Ensuring their reliability not only enhances the performance of vehicles but also contributes to overall safety and customer satisfaction. 1. High – Quality Materials Selection

The foundation of a reliable automotive brushless motor lies in the quality of materials used in its construction. When it comes to the stator, using high – grade electrical steel can significantly reduce core losses and improve magnetic performance. Electrical steel with low hysteresis and eddy – current losses leads to more efficient operation, which in turn reduces heat generation. Excessive heat is one of the main factors that can degrade motor components over time, so minimizing it is crucial for long – term reliability.

For the rotor, permanent magnets are a key component. High – energy – product rare – earth magnets, such as neodymium – iron – boron (NdFeB) magnets, offer strong magnetic fields, which improve the motor’s torque density and efficiency. However, these magnets need to be carefully protected from demagnetization, which can occur due to high temperatures and external magnetic fields. Coating the magnets with protective layers can help prevent corrosion and physical damage, ensuring their magnetic properties remain stable throughout the motor’s lifespan.

The insulation materials used in the motor windings also play an important role. High – quality insulation materials with good thermal resistance and dielectric strength can prevent short – circuits and electrical breakdowns. These materials should be able to withstand the operating temperatures and voltage stresses within the motor for an extended period.

2. Advanced Design and Engineering

The design of an automotive brushless motor can have a profound impact on its reliability. One aspect is the electromagnetic design. A well – designed magnetic circuit can ensure uniform distribution of magnetic flux, reducing torque ripple and vibration. Torque ripple can cause mechanical stress on the motor shaft and other components, leading to premature wear and failure. By using advanced simulation tools, engineers can optimize the magnetic circuit design to achieve smooth torque output.

Thermal design is another critical area. Efficient heat dissipation is essential for maintaining the motor’s performance and reliability. Designing the motor with proper ventilation channels or incorporating heat sinks can help transfer heat away from the critical components. For example, some automotive brushless motors are designed with hollow shafts that allow for air circulation, which enhances cooling efficiency.

In addition, the mechanical design of the motor should be robust to withstand the harsh operating conditions in vehicles. This includes considering factors such as vibration, shock, and dust ingress. Using high – quality bearings, proper sealing, and a rigid housing can protect the internal components from damage and ensure stable operation.

3. Rigorous Manufacturing Processes

The manufacturing process of automotive brushless motors must be strictly controlled to ensure high quality and reliability. Precision machining of the motor components is essential. For example, the stator laminations need to be stamped with high accuracy to ensure proper alignment and minimize air – gap variations. Any misalignment or irregularities in the air – gap can lead to uneven magnetic forces, which can cause vibration and reduce the motor’s efficiency.

Winding the motor coils is another critical step. The winding process should be carefully controlled to ensure consistent turn count, proper insulation, and correct connection. Automated winding machines can provide higher precision and repeatability compared to manual winding. After winding, the coils need to be impregnated with insulating varnish to improve their mechanical strength and electrical insulation properties.

Assembly of the motor components also requires strict quality control. All parts should be properly aligned and tightened to prevent loosening during operation. During the assembly process, it is important to follow a clean – room environment as much as possible to prevent the ingress of dust and debris, which can cause short – circuits or damage to the bearings.

4. Comprehensive Testing and Quality Assurance

Before the automotive brushless motors are delivered to customers, they must undergo a series of comprehensive tests to ensure their reliability. Electrical tests, such as resistance measurement, insulation resistance testing, and dielectric strength testing, can detect any electrical faults in the motor. These tests help identify issues such as short – circuits, open – circuits, or poor insulation.

Performance tests are also crucial. Torque – speed characteristics, efficiency, and power consumption are measured to ensure that the motor meets the specified performance requirements. Thermal tests can monitor the temperature rise of the motor under different operating conditions. This helps to verify that the cooling design is effective and that the motor can operate within the safe temperature range.

In addition, environmental tests are conducted to simulate the harsh conditions that the motor may encounter in real – world applications. These tests include temperature cycling, humidity testing, vibration testing, and shock testing. By subjecting the motor to these extreme conditions, any potential weaknesses in the design or manufacturing process can be identified and corrected.

5. Effective Maintenance and Support

Even with high – quality design, manufacturing, and testing, proper maintenance is essential to ensure the long – term reliability of automotive brushless motors. As a supplier, we should provide customers with detailed maintenance instructions. This includes information on lubricating the bearings, checking the insulation resistance regularly, and inspecting for any signs of wear or damage.
